Predicate: extricate

Roleset id: extricate.01 , remove thyself, Source: , vncls: , framnet:

extricate.01: EXTRICATE-V NOTES: Frames file for 'extricate' based on sentences in wsj. No Verbnet entry. (from extricate.01-v predicate notes)

Aliases:

AliasFrameNetVerbNet
extricate (v.)

Roles:

        Arg0-PAG: agent of removing
        Arg1-PPT: thing removed
        Arg2-DIR: from where

Example: cosmic justice

        person: ns,  tense: ns,  aspect: ns,  voice: ns,  form: infinitive

        A spot honoring Bill White, the inventor of chewing gum, shows [a woman]-1 trying [*-1]to extricate her high-heeled shoe from a wad of gum.

        Arg0: [*-1]
        Rel: extricate
        Arg1: her high-heeled shoe
        Arg2: from a wad of gum
